Huawei Mate 20 is a bit better than the Moto X Style, getting a 79.5 score against 74.1. The Huawei Mate 20 body is a lot newer and notably thinner than Moto X Style's, but it's a little bit heavier. Huawei Mate 20 has just a bit better looking display than Motorola Moto X Style, because although it has a little worse resolution of 1080 x 2244px and a much lower screen density, it also counts with a bit bigger screen.
Huawei Mate 20 counts with a bit faster processor than Moto X Style, because it has a higher number of cores and 1 GB more RAM. The Motorola Moto X Style shoots a little bit better pictures and videos than Huawei Mate 20, because although it has a smaller back camera sensor capturing worse quality pictures and a smaller aperture which is not favorable for shooting pictures and/or video in low light environments, and they both have the same 30 fps video frame rates and the same (4K) video definition, the Motorola Moto X Style also counts with a lot better 21 mega-pixels resolution camera.
The Huawei Mate 20 counts with slightly more memory for games and applications than Motorola Moto X Style,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with 64 GB more internal storage. Huawei Mate 20 counts with better battery duration than Motorola Moto X Style, because it has a 4000mAh battery capacity.
